在当今数字化时代,网络安全已成为企业和个人用户不可忽视的重要议题,随着远程办公、云服务和移动设备的普及,数据传输的安全性愈发关键,在此背景下,SSL(Secure Sockets Layer)和VPN(Virtual Private Network)作为两大主流加密通信技术,广泛应用于各类网络场景中,尽管它们都致力于保护数据隐私和完整性,但两者在工作原理、应用场景、部署方式以及安全性方面存在本质差异,本文将深入剖析SSL与VPN的区别,帮助网络工程师和技术决策者更清晰地理解其适用场景。
从技术定义来看,SSL是一种传输层加密协议,主要用于保障Web浏览器与服务器之间的通信安全,它通过数字证书验证服务器身份,并使用对称加密和非对称加密结合的方式加密数据流,从而防止中间人攻击、窃听或篡改,SSL现已演进为TLS(Transport Layer Security),但业界仍习惯称为SSL,典型应用包括HTTPS网站、在线支付、电子邮件客户端等。
而VPN是一种网络层隧道技术,它通过在公共互联网上建立加密通道,将用户设备与私有网络连接起来,使远程用户如同直接接入内网一般,VPN通常使用IPSec、OpenVPN、L2TP等协议构建虚拟隧道,实现端到端的数据加密和身份认证,其核心价值在于提供“私有网络”体验——无论用户身处何地,只要连接到VPN服务器,即可访问企业内部资源(如文件服务器、数据库、ERP系统等)。
两者的根本区别体现在以下几个方面:
-
加密层级不同
SSL工作在传输层(TCP/IP模型的第四层),加密的是单个应用会话(如网页请求),仅保护特定服务的数据流;而VPN工作在网络层(第三层),加密的是整个IP数据包,涵盖所有流量(包括HTTP、FTP、DNS等),适用于全网络访问控制。 -
部署范围与灵活性
SSL常用于网站安全,部署简单,只需在Web服务器安装SSL证书即可,适合面向公众的服务;而VPN需要部署专用服务器(如Cisco ASA、FortiGate或开源方案如OpenVPN Server),并配置客户端软件,更适合企业级员工远程办公或分支机构互联。 -
身份认证机制
SSL主要依赖服务器证书进行单向认证(部分支持双向认证),用户无需额外身份验证;而VPN普遍采用多因素认证(如用户名+密码+硬件令牌),确保只有授权用户才能接入内网,安全性更高。 -
性能影响
SSL加密开销较小,对带宽和延迟影响轻微,适合高并发Web服务;而VPN因需封装整个IP包,可能带来一定性能损耗,尤其在跨地域连接时需优化隧道质量。 -
应用场景对比
- 若你只需要保护一个网站(如电商、银行登录页),SSL是首选;
- 若你需要让员工安全访问公司内部系统(如OA、CRM),则应部署VPN;
- 现代趋势是“SSL-VPN”融合方案,即基于SSL协议的轻量级远程访问解决方案(如SSL-VPN网关),兼顾便捷性和安全性,成为中小企业的热门选择。
SSL与VPN并非对立关系,而是互补技术,SSL解决“点对点通信”的安全问题,VPN解决“网络边界扩展”的安全挑战,网络工程师应根据业务需求、用户规模、安全策略和运维能力,合理选择或组合使用这两种技术,构建纵深防御体系,随着零信任架构(Zero Trust)的兴起,SSL与VPN的边界将进一步模糊,但其核心价值——加密、认证、隔离——仍是网络安全的基石。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






